From owner-freebsd-gnome@FreeBSD.ORG Thu Dec 23 16:13:07 2010 Return-Path: Delivered-To: gnome@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id F3CB0106564A for ; Thu, 23 Dec 2010 16:13:06 +0000 (UTC) (envelope-from mezz.freebsd@gmail.com) Received: from mail-fx0-f54.google.com (mail-fx0-f54.google.com [209.85.161.54]) by mx1.freebsd.org (Postfix) with ESMTP id 861AE8FC14 for ; Thu, 23 Dec 2010 16:13:06 +0000 (UTC) Received: by fxm16 with SMTP id 16so6879265fxm.13 for ; Thu, 23 Dec 2010 08:13:05 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:received:in-reply-to :references:date:message-id:subject:from:to:cc:content-type :content-transfer-encoding; bh=vhE4RSNH0/nYqAn3ALrGHgVj9ecSEaVF8uXlUQ/GuCs=; b=oPg+Vi+jClEmh9dVGFMrWMmB/iYd/oem/p9fgE6P/GsPk1q7y7UGkQkEcj06ulIXNW QqaqaxO05Sac3FUQLTZDtBCumBDu7PKcyz1tpLSf3ORssXa/eGqU9K0h7NUENAQyJlnq 2M2lzi/WnCMkLVpgV/N0rviThAX/KtsvjPr7k=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type:content-transfer-encoding; b=MwG5TKDlTiSN6j79upZDeuuYBxty6S8TlV3Zin35zKM3N9CfEhkDnQjkO+iFy4dujY NH7XrfLNH87oGWNruxteXoWoFoM5gun/l7zoMim6i/J763UDnZP0M+vMOp5y22pRyzJP cucrE4YKrQajSPYnlWIfRe0N56qrvfZ16D0KA= MIME-Version: 1.0 Received: by 10.223.112.1 with SMTP id u1mr779742fap.109.1293120785336; Thu, 23 Dec 2010 08:13:05 -0800 (PST) Received: by 10.223.70.196 with HTTP; Thu, 23 Dec 2010 08:13:05 -0800 (PST) In-Reply-To: <7DAE8155-BE55-489D-82EC-49F68541C93F@gmail.com> References: <423C51EA-8BB0-4C38-8B53-1047A211D352@gmail.com> <7DAE8155-BE55-489D-82EC-49F68541C93F@gmail.com> Date: Thu, 23 Dec 2010 10:13:05 -0600 Message-ID: From: Jeremy Messenger To: Paul Beard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Cc: gnome@freebsd.org Subject: Re: telepathy-glib fails: bailing on /usr/include/machine/endian.h? X-BeenThere: freebsd-gnome@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: GNOME for FreeBSD -- porting and maintaining List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 23 Dec 2010 16:13:07 -0000 On Thu, Dec 23, 2010 at 2:11 AM, Paul Beard wrote: > > On Dec 22, 2010, at 9:52 AM, Jeremy Messenger wrote: > >> You need to update your gobject-introspection as it was fixed over a >> year ago. Be sure to read in the /usr/ports/UPDATING before you try to >> update it alone. > > > In the process of rebuilding all things GNOME, this issue with /usr/inclu= de/machine/endian.h crops up other places, too. > > > Making all in polkitgtk > gmake[2]: Entering directory `/usr/ports/sysutils/polkit-gnome/work/polki= t-gnome-0.99/polkitgtk' > =A0CC =A0 =A0 libpolkit_gtk_1_la-polkitlockbutton.lo > =A0CCLD =A0 libpolkit-gtk-1.la > =A0CC =A0 =A0 example-example.o > =A0CCLD =A0 example > /usr/local/bin/g-ir-scanner -v =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--namespace PolkitGtk =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 \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--strip-prefix=3DPolkit =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 \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--nsversion=3D1.0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 \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--include=3DGtk-2.0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 \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--include=3DPolkit-1.0 =A0 =A0 =A0 =A0 =A0= =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--library=3Dpolkit-gtk-1 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--output PolkitGtk-1.0.gir =A0 =A0 =A0 =A0= =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--pkg=3Dpolkit-gobject-1 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--pkg=3Dgtk+-2.0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0--libtool=3D../libtool =A0 =A0 =A0 =A0 =A0= =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0-I.. =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0-DPOLKIT_GTK_COMPILATION =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0./polkitgtk.h =A0 =A0 =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0 =A0 \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0./polkitgtktypes.h =A0 =A0 =A0 =A0 =A0 =A0= =A0 =A0 =A0 =A0 =A0\ > =A0 =A0 =A0 =A0 =A0 =A0 =A0 =A0./polkitlockbutton.h =A0 =A0 =A0 =A0 =A0 = =A0 =A0 =A0 =A0 =A0\ > > g-ir-scanner: warning: Option --strip-prefix has been deprecated; > see --identifier-prefix and --symbol-prefix. > /usr/include/machine/endian.h:107: syntax error, unexpected '{' in ' retu= rn (__extension__ ({ register __uint32_t __X =3D (_x); __asm ("bswap %0" : = "+r" (__X)); __X; }));' at '{' > /usr/include/machine/endian.h:107: syntax error, unexpected ';' in ' retu= rn (__extension__ ({ register __uint32_t __X =3D (_x); __asm ("bswap %0" : = "+r" (__X)); __X; }));' at ';' > > > There is a note in UPDATING dated Jan 22. 2010 about policy kit. In all t= he portupgrade cycles I've run since then, as well as upgrading from 7.2 to= 8.0 and 8.1, this is only coming up now? > > I got over the issue with telepathy-glib with pkg_add but it installed pe= rl 5.10 which I replaced with 5.12 ages ago. Hope that doesn't hose things = up. Can you show us the full log of build failure? Do you have symlink on /usr/local or anywhere? Cheers, Mezz > -- > Paul Beard > > Are you trying to win an argument or solve a problem? --=20 mezz.freebsd@gmail.com - mezz@FreeBSD.org FreeBSD GNOME Team http://www.FreeBSD.org/gnome/ - gnome@FreeBSD.org